Job Description

Description:
Be the First Step in Someone's Care Journey We're a small but mighty nonprofit healthcare organization looking for a welcoming, organized, and reliable Front Desk Receptionist / Scheduler to join our team! In this role, you'll be the first friendly face our patients see—and the calm, reassuring voice when they call. You'll help create a smooth, supportive experience for everyone walking through our doors. This position is being posted as a temporary assignment to cover a leave of absence. While employment beyond the temporary assignment is not guaranteed, candidates should be aware that a permanent opportunity may become available based on organizational needs and staffing requirements. The schedule will be Monday - Friday, 8:00am - 5:00pm.
What You'll Do:
Greet patients with warmth and manage appointment scheduling Handle phone calls, messages, and voicemails like a pro Keep patient info up-to-date and confidential (HIPAA matters!) Post payments and support daily front office operations Be an essential part of our team with a focus on excellent patient care
What You'll Get:
$15 - 17 per hour, paid biweekly Flexible part-time schedule A fun, supportive team and meaningful work in your community
Requirements:
High school diploma or equivalent At least 1 year of front desk or customer service experience Friendly, detail-oriented, and ready to learn Bonus points if you have healthcare experience, are bilingual (Spanish/English), or know your way around Athena EMR!
